CS5174ED8G Description
The CS5174ED8G is a versatile DC switching voltage regulator from onsemi, designed to offer adjustable output voltage with a wide input voltage range. This regulator supports multiple topologies, including Buck, Boost, Flyback, Forward Converter, and SEPIC, making it suitable for a variety of power conversion applications. The device features a maximum input voltage of 30V and a minimum input voltage of 2.7V, providing flexibility in power supply design. With a switching frequency of 560kHz, the CS5174ED8G ensures efficient power conversion and reduced component size. The regulator is capable of delivering up to 1.5A of output current, making it ideal for applications requiring high current delivery. The output configuration is adjustable, allowing for both positive and negative outputs. The CS5174ED8G is housed in an 8SOIC package and is available in tube packaging. CS5174ED8G Features
- Adjustable Output Voltage: The CS5174ED8G offers adjustable output voltage, providing flexibility to meet the specific requirements of various applications.
- Wide Input Voltage Range: With an input voltage range from 2.7V to 30V, the regulator can operate efficiently across a broad spectrum of input conditions.
- High Current Capability: The device supports up to 1.5A of output current, making it suitable for applications requiring high current delivery.
- Multiple Topologies: The regulator supports multiple topologies, including Buck, Boost, Flyback, Forward Converter, and SEPIC, enhancing its versatility.
- High Switching Frequency: The 560kHz switching frequency ensures efficient power conversion and allows for the use of smaller inductors and capacitors.
- Positive or Negative Output Configuration: The regulator can be configured for either positive or negative output, providing additional flexibility in circuit design.
- Surface Mount Technology: The surface mount design facilitates easy integration into compact and high-density PCB layouts.
- REACH Compliance: The CS5174ED8G is REACH unaffected, ensuring compliance with environmental and safety regulations.
- Moisture Sensitivity Level: With an MSL rating of 1 (Unlimited), the device is suitable for use in various environmental conditions without the need for special handling.
